Young People
Sex can feel really great, especially with someone that you really like, but when you start to have sex you have to be able to take responsibility for your actions and for your feelings.  By practising safer sex (using condoms) you are protecting yourself and your partner against STIs.

Age of Consent
In Scotland it is legal for men and women to have Sex once they are over 16 years of age.  It is legal for men to have sex with men if they are both over 16 years of age.
